Phytoestrogen Supplements Market, Segmentation by Type
The Type segmentation identifies the different types of phytoestrogens present in supplements, which play a crucial role in health benefits such as hormone balance, skin health, and prevention of chronic diseases.
Flavonoids
Flavonoids are one of the most abundant classes of phytoestrogens found in plants. These compounds have antioxidant properties and are used in supplements to support cardiovascular health, enhance skin vitality, and improve metabolic function.
Daidzen
Daidzen is a type of isoflavone found predominantly in soy. It is known for its estrogen-like effects and is often included in supplements for menopause symptom relief and bone health maintenance.
Denistein
Denistein is another key isoflavone from soy, commonly used in phytoestrogen supplements due to its potential in hormone regulation and cancer prevention, particularly in breast and prostate cancer studies.
Glycitein
Glycitein is an isoflavone found in soy that has been researched for its potential to reduce the risk of chronic conditions like osteoporosis and heart disease. It is often found in specialized phytoestrogen supplements.
Biochanin A
Biochanin A is a potent flavonoid with strong antioxidant properties, found in red clover. It has estrogenic effects that make it valuable in supplements aimed at relieving menopausal symptoms and improving bone health.
Coumestans
Coumestans are a group of phytoestrogens found in plants like clover and beans. They are known for their ability to mimic estrogen, which may help alleviate menopausal symptoms and support hormone balance.
Prenyl Flavonoids
Prenyl Flavonoids are another class of flavonoids with potent antioxidant properties. Found in hops and other plants, they are believed to contribute to better hormone regulation and may support breast health in women.
Lignans
Lignans are plant compounds found in seeds, particularly flaxseeds, and have been shown to have estrogenic effects. They are commonly included in phytoestrogen supplements to support hormonal balance and cardiovascular health.
Stilbenes
Stilbenes are phytoestrogens found in plants such as red wine and peanuts. They have been linked to a variety of health benefits, including anti-aging effects, and are often used in supplements targeting skin health and anti-inflammatory properties.
Others
Other types of phytoestrogens found in supplements include various flavonoids and plant extracts, each offering unique benefits for hormone regulation, skin health, and disease prevention.
Phytoestrogen Supplements Market, Segmentation by Source
The Source segmentation identifies the natural sources from which phytoestrogen supplements are derived. The diversity of sources influences the specific types of phytoestrogens present in each supplement and determines its primary health benefits.
Nuts & Oilseeds
Nuts & Oilseeds, such as flaxseeds, sesame seeds, and sunflower seeds, are rich in lignans, a type of phytoestrogen. These sources provide high amounts of antioxidants and estrogenic compounds that support hormonal balance and cardiovascular health.
Soy Products
Soy Products are among the most widely used sources of phytoestrogens, particularly isoflavones such as daidzen and genistein. Soy-based supplements are popular for relieving menopausal symptoms and supporting bone density in postmenopausal women.
Cereals & Bread
Cereals & Bread containing flaxseeds, oats, and barley are also sources of phytoestrogens. These food sources contribute to heart health and hormonal balance, making them beneficial for individuals seeking to manage estrogen levels naturally.
Legumes
Legumes, such as beans, peas, and lentils, contain phytoestrogens like coumestans and isoflavones. They are essential dietary sources of estrogen-like compounds that support reproductive health and hormone regulation in both men and women.
Meat Products
Meat Products are not typically rich in phytoestrogens but may contain trace amounts of these compounds. In the context of phytoestrogen supplements, meat is usually paired with other plant-based sources for balanced supplementation.
Others
Other Sources include plant-based foods such as vegetables, fruits, and herbs that provide various forms of phytoestrogens. These include natural extracts like red clover and hops, which are frequently included in supplements for menopausal symptom relief and bone health.

Expanding research on the health benefits of phytoestrogens - Expanding research on the health benefits of phytoestrogens is driving significant interest and investment in understanding the potential therapeutic applications of these natural compounds. Phytoestrogens, found in various plant-based foods and dietary supplements, have been studied extensively for their estrogen-like properties and potential health-promoting effects. As researchers delve deeper into the mechanisms of action and physiological effects of phytoestrogens, emerging evidence suggests a wide range of potential health benefits, from hormonal balance to cardiovascular health and beyond.
One area of research focus is the role of phytoestrogens in supporting hormonal balance and menopausal health. Studies have shown that phytoestrogens, such as isoflavones found in soy and red clover, may help alleviate menopausal symptoms such as hot flashes, night sweats, and mood disturbances by exerting weak estrogenic effects in the body. Additionally, phytoestrogens may play a role in maintaining bone density, reducing the risk of osteoporosis, and promoting overall bone health, particularly in postmenopausal women at risk of bone loss.
Beyond hormonal health, expanding research suggests that phytoestrogens may have broader implications for cardiovascular health and disease prevention. Isoflavones, lignans, and other phytoestrogenic compounds found in nuts, seeds, whole grains, and legumes have been associated with improved lipid profiles, reduced inflammation, and enhanced vascular function, which may help lower the risk of cardiovascular disease and related complications. Furthermore, phytoestrogens may exhibit ant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ties that protect against oxidative stress and chronic inflammation, both of which are implicated in the development of cardiovascular disorders.
In addition to hormonal and cardiovascular health, ongoing research is exploring the potential anticancer properties of phytoestrogens, particularly in relation to hormone-related cancers such as breast and prostate cancer. Studies have suggested that phytoestrogens may modulate hormone receptor signaling, inhibit tumor growth and metastasis, and induce apoptosis (programmed cell death) in cancer cells, offering promising avenues for cancer prevention and adjuvant therapy. However, the precise mechanisms underlying the anticancer effects of phytoestrogens and their optimal therapeutic doses require further investigation.
Expanding research is shedding light on the potential neuroprotective effects of phytoestrogens, particularly in relation to cognitive function and brain health. Preliminary studies suggest that phytoestrogens may exert neuroprotective effects, enhance synaptic plasticity, and reduce the risk of neurodegenerative disorders such as Alzheimer's disease and Parkinson's disease. These findings highlight the importance of further research into the neuroprotective mechanisms of phytoestrogens and their potential applications in brain health and cognitive aging.

Regulatory uncertainty and compliance challenges - Regulatory uncertainty and compliance challenges pose significant hurdles for the global phytoestrogen supplements market, impacting manufacturers, distributors, and consumers alike. These challenges stem from the complex and evolving regulatory landscape governing dietary supplements, botanical ingredients, and health claims, which vary across different regions and jurisdictions.
One of the primary regulatory challenges facing the phytoestrogen supplements market is the lack of standardized regulations and harmonized guidelines for evaluating the safety, efficacy, and quality of these products. Regulatory agencies in different countries may have divergent requirements for the registration, labeling, and marketing of dietary supplements containing phytoestrogenic compounds, leading to compliance complexities and market access barriers for manufacturers seeking to expand their global footprint.
Regulatory authorities often grapple with the classification and categorization of phytoestrogen supplements, as these products straddle the line between dietary supplements, functional foods, and herbal medicines, each subject to distinct regulatory frameworks and oversight mechanisms. The classification of phytoestrogens as either dietary ingredients or medicinal substances may impact the regulatory requirements for product registration, labeling claims, and post-market surveillance, creating compliance challenges for manufacturers navigating multiple regulatory pathways.
In addition to regulatory classification, ensuring compliance with quality and safety standards poses another significant challenge for phytoestrogen supplement manufacturers. Quality control measures, such as identity testing, potency analysis, and purity assessments, are essential for verifying the authenticity and integrity of botanical ingredients and ensuring product consistency and safety. However, variability in raw material sourcing, extraction processes, and formulation techniques can complicate quality assurance efforts, leading to inconsistencies in product quality and safety standards across different batches and suppliers.
